Understanding the Role of Pheromones in Animal Communication

Pheromones play a crucial role in the communication between members of the same species, influencing behaviors like mating and territory marking. These specialized chemical signals affect social interactions and responses in the animal kingdom, showcasing the fascinating link between biology and behavior.

What Exactly Are Pheromones?

Pheromones are a type of chemical communication, and this isn’t just dry scientific jargon; it’s a vital aspect of how many species interact. So, what’s the catch? Well, pheromones are special chemicals that are released by organisms and detected by others of the same species. That’s right—they only work within species, which makes them quite specific and crucial for various behaviors. You might even think of them as nature’s very own messaging system!

To illustrate, imagine a club filled with people—all dancing and enjoying themselves. Suddenly, a certain aroma wafts through the room, and everyone knows it’s time to hit the dance floor. In the same way, pheromones send out signals about mating, territory, or danger, stirring social behaviors. It's like an unseen cue that can either bring members of a species together or alert them to issues that might be lurking just around the corner.

The Key Role of Pheromones in Behavior

So, what best summarizes what these chemicals do? Drumroll, please... they affect the behavior of conspecifics. It’s a fancy term, but it means individuals of the same species. The heart of the matter is that pheromones are all about communication. They articulate a range of messages, from mating signals to territorial markings, and even alarming calls.

Think of it this way: when one bee releases a pheromone to signal danger to fellow hive members, it doesn’t just keep that warning to itself. A small drop of this chemical can lead to a complex, coordinated response, allowing the entire colony to react. They know what's up because of these subtle, invisible cues. Isn’t nature something?
